Understanding UV DTF Printing Process
UV DTF, or Ultraviolet Direct to Film printing, utilizes a unique process that differentiates it from traditional methods. This technique involves printing vibrant designs onto a special film using UV-curable inks which cure almost instantaneously upon exposure to ultraviolet light. The immediate curing not only enhances productivity but also ensures that the prints maintain their rich colors and intricate details without any degradation.
As a result of this sophisticated process, UV DTF printing is exceptionally suited for high-volume orders where precision and detail are paramount. The ability to employ sustainable printing solutions within this framework paves the way for more eco-aware businesses to deliver custom textile printing options without compromising quality or performance.

Sustainable Printing Solutions with UV DTF printing
In an era where sustainability is paramount, UV DTF printing is emerging as a preferred choice for eco-conscious businesses. The UV inks utilized in this technique often contain low volatile organic compounds (VOCs), aligning with stricter environmental guidelines. This eco-friendly approach not only reduces chemical emissions but also supports the growing trend towards sustainable printing solutions.
Moreover, the efficiency of the UV DTF process minimizes waste during production, making it a conscientious alternative for providers looking to lower their carbon footprint.
